#!/usr/bin/env python3 """ 项目记忆加载器 v2.0 用于调用项目记忆 API 获取项目上下文信息 功能: - 加载项目上下文(PROJECT.md + TODO + 记忆数据) - 离线模式支持 - 记忆质量评分 - 重复记忆合并 - 过期记忆清理 - 自动维护 API 端点:http://localhost:5000/api/project-memory/context """ import argparse import json import os import re import sys from datetime import datetime from pathlib import Path from typing import Any, Dict, List, Optional try: import requests except ImportError: requests = None print("Warning: requests module not installed. Offline mode will be used.", file=sys.stderr) # 配置 DEFAULT_API_URL = "http://localhost:5000/api/project-memory/context" PROJECT_ROOT = os.environ.get("COZE_WORKSPACE_PATH", "/workspace/projects") OFFLINE_MODE = os.environ.get("OFFLINE_MODE", "").lower() in ("true", "1", "yes") class ProjectContextLoader: """项目上下文加载器""" def __init__( self, api_url: str = DEFAULT_API_URL, offline: bool = False, timeout: int = 10 ): self.api_url = api_url self.offline = offline or OFFLINE_MODE or requests is None self.timeout = timeout self.project_root = Path(PROJECT_ROOT) def load_context( self, format: str = "json", refresh: bool = False, compact: bool = False ) -> Dict[str, Any]: """ 加载项目上下文 Args: format: 返回格式 (json/markdown) refresh: 是否强制刷新缓存 compact: 是否使用精简模式 Returns: 项目上下文数据 """ if self.offline: return self._load_offline() return self._load_from_api(format, refresh, compact) def _load_from_api( self, format: str, refresh: bool, compact: bool ) -> Dict[str, Any]: """从 API 加载上下文""" params = {} if format == "markdown": params["format"] = "markdown" if refresh: params["refresh"] = "true" if compact: params["compact"] = "true" try: response = requests.get( self.api_url, params=params, headers={"Accept": "application/json"}, timeout=self.timeout ) if response.status_code == 200: if format == "markdown": return { "success": True, "format": "markdown", "content": response.text } return response.json() elif response.status_code == 404: return { "success": False, "error": "API 端点不存在,请确认 API 服务已正确配置", "fallback": self._load_offline() } else: return { "success": False, "error": f"API 请求失败,状态码: {response.status_code}", "fallback": self._load_offline() } except requests.exceptions.ConnectionError: return { "success": False, "error": "无法连接到 API 服务,使用离线模式", "offline": True, "fallback": self._load_offline() } except requests.exceptions.Timeout: return { "success": False, "error": "API 请求超时", "fallback": self._load_offline() } except Exception as e: return { "success": False, "error": f"API 请求异常: {str(e)}", "fallback": self._load_offline() } def _load_offline(self) -> Dict[str, Any]: """离线模式:直接读取本地文件""" result = { "success": True, "offline": True, "loadedAt": datetime.now().isoformat(), "project": {}, "todos": {"pending": [], "inProgress": [], "completed": []}, "memories": {"recent": [], "highPriority": []}, "redLines": [], "commonErrors": [], "devGuide": {"quickCommands": [], "coreFiles": []} } # 读取 PROJECT.md project_md = self._read_project_md() if project_md: result["project"] = project_md["project"] result["todos"] = project_md["todos"] # 读取压缩摘要 summary = self._read_summary_md() if summary: result["todos"].update(summary.get("todos", {})) result["redLines"] = summary.get("redLines", []) result["commonErrors"] = summary.get("commonErrors", []) result["devGuide"] = summary.get("devGuide", {}) return result def _read_project_md(self) -> Optional[Dict[str, Any]]: """读取 PROJECT.md""" project_path = self.project_root / "PROJECT.md" if not project_path.exists(): return None try: content = project_path.read_text(encoding="utf-8") return self._parse_project_md(content) except Exception as e: return {"error": str(e)} def _parse_project_md(self, content: str) -> Dict[str, Any]: """解析 PROJECT.md 内容""" result = { "project": {}, "todos": {"pending": [], "inProgress": [], "completed": []} } # 解析基本信息 name_match = re.search(r"\*\*名称\*\*\s*\|\s*(.+)", content) version_match = re.search(r"\*\*版本\*\*\s*\|\s*(.+)", content) tech_match = re.search(r"\*\*技术栈\*\*\s*\|\s*(.+)", content) result["project"] = { "name": name_match.group(1).strip() if name_match else "工资表SaaS系统", "version": version_match.group(1).strip() if version_match else "0.5.0", "techStack": [t.strip() for t in tech_match.group(1).split(",")] if tech_match else [], "port": 5000 } # 解析待开发功能 pending_section = re.search(r"## 🚧 待开发功能[\s\S]*?(?=##|$)", content) if pending_section: lines = pending_section.group(0).split("\n") current_priority = "normal" for line in lines: priority_match = re.match(r"### (P\d+):", line) if priority_match: p_num = int(priority_match.group(1)[1:]) current_priority = "critical" if p_num <= 1 else ("high" if p_num == 2 else "normal") item_match = re.match(r"- \[ \] (.+)", line) if item_match: result["todos"]["pending"].append({ "content": item_match.group(1).strip(), "priority": current_priority, "status": "pending" }) # 解析已完成功能 completed_section = re.search(r"## ✅ 已完成功能[\s\S]*?(?=##|$)", content) if completed_section: lines = completed_section.group(0).split("\n") for line in lines: item_match = re.match(r"### (P\d+): (.+)", line) if item_match: result["todos"]["completed"].append({ "content": item_match.group(2).strip(), "priority": "normal", "status": "completed" }) return result def _read_summary_md(self) -> Optional[Dict[str, Any]]: """读取压缩摘要""" summary_path = self.project_root / "docs/17-其他/压缩摘要.md" if not summary_path.exists(): return None try: content = summary_path.read_text(encoding="utf-8") return self._parse_summary_md(content) except Exception as e: return {"error": str(e)} def _parse_summary_md(self, content: str) -> Dict[str, Any]: """解析压缩摘要内容""" result = { "todos": {"pending": [], "inProgress": [], "completed": []}, "redLines": [], "commonErrors": [], "devGuide": {"quickCommands": [], "coreFiles": []} } # 解析 TODO todo_section = re.search(r"## TODO[\s\S]*?(?=##|$)", content) if todo_section: lines = todo_section.group(0).split("\n") for line in lines: item_match = re.match(r"- (.+)", line) if item_match and "TODO" not in item_match.group(1): result["todos"]["pending"].append({ "content": item_match.group(1).strip(), "priority": "normal", "status": "pending" }) # 解析常见错误 error_section = re.search(r"## 🐛 常见错误速查[\s\S]*?(?=##|$)", content) if error_section: lines = error_section.group(0).split("\n") for line in lines: match = re.match(r"\|\s*(.+?)\s*\|\s*(.+?)\s*\|\s*(.+?)\s*\|", line) if match and match.group(1) != "错误": result["commonErrors"].append({ "error": match.group(1).strip(), "cause": match.group(2).strip(), "solution": match.group(3).strip() }) # 解析快速命令 cmd_section = re.search(r"## ⚡ 快速命令[\s\S]*?(?=##|$)", content) if cmd_section: lines = cmd_section.group(0).split("\n") for line in lines: match = re.match(r"\|\s*`?([^`|\n]+)`?\s*\|\s*(.+?)\s*\|\s*(.+?)\s*\|", line) if match and match.group(1) != "命令": result["devGuide"]["quickCommands"].append({ "command": match.group(1).strip(), "purpose": match.group(2).strip(), "when": match.group(3).strip() }) return result def generate_markdown_summary(self, context: Dict[str, Any]) -> str: """生成 Markdown 格式的摘要""" md = "# 📋 项目状态概览\n\n" md += f"> 加载时间: {datetime.now().strftime('%Y/%m/%d %H:%M:%S')}\n" md += f"> API 状态: {'❌ 离线模式' if context.get('offline') else '✅ 在线'}\n\n" # 项目信息 project = context.get("project", {}) if project: md += "## 📦 项目信息\n" md += "| 项目 | 内容 |\n" md += "|------|------|\n" md += f"| **名称** | {project.get('name', 'N/A')} |\n" md += f"| **版本** | {project.get('version', 'N/A')} |\n" md += f"| **技术栈** | {', '.join(project.get('techStack', []))} |\n" md += f"| **端口** | {project.get('port', 5000)} |\n\n" # TODO 列表 todos = context.get("todos", {}) pending = todos.get("pending", []) if pending: md += "## 📝 待办事项\n" for todo in pending[:10]: priority = todo.get("priority", "normal") icon = "🔴" if priority == "critical" else ("🟡" if priority == "high" else "⚪") md += f"- {icon} {todo.get('content', '')}\n" md += "\n" # 最近记忆 memories = context.get("memories", {}) recent = memories.get("recent", []) if recent: md += "## 🧠 最近记忆\n" for m in recent[:5]: md += f"- **[{m.get('type', 'unknown')}]** {m.get('title', '')}\n" md += "\n" # 高优先级记忆 high_priority = memories.get("highPriority", []) if high_priority: md += "## ⭐ 重要事项\n" for m in high_priority[:5]: importance = m.get("importance", "normal").upper() md += f"- **[{importance}]** {m.get('title', '')}\n" md += "\n" # 红线规则 red_lines = context.get("redLines", []) if red_lines: md += "## 🚨 关键红线\n" for i, rule in enumerate(red_lines[:5], 1): md += f"{i}. {rule.get('title', rule.get('category', ''))}: {rule.get('description', '')[:50]}...\n" md += "\n" # 快速命令 dev_guide = context.get("devGuide", {}) commands = dev_guide.get("quickCommands", []) if commands: md += "## ⚡ 快速命令\n" md += "| 命令 | 用途 |\n" md += "|------|------|\n" for cmd in commands[:5]: md += f"| `{cmd.get('command', '')}` | {cmd.get('purpose', '')} |\n" md += "\n" return md def call_maintenance_action( self, action: str, dry_run: bool = False, **kwargs ) -> Dict[str, Any]: """ 调用维护动作 Args: action: 动作类型 (quality/merge/cleanup/maintenance/report) dry_run: 是否试运行 Returns: 动作结果 """ if self.offline: return { "success": False, "error": "离线模式不支持维护操作" } api_url = self.api_url.replace("/context", "/maintenance") try: response = requests.post( api_url, json={ "action": action, "dryRun": dry_run, **kwargs }, headers={"Content-Type": "application/json"}, timeout=self.timeout * 2 ) if response.status_code == 200: return response.json() else: return { "success": False, "error": f"API 请求失败,状态码: {response.status_code}" } except Exception as e: return { "success": False, "error": str(e) } def main(): """主函数""" parser = argparse.ArgumentParser( description="项目记忆加载器 v2.0 - 加载项目上下文信息", formatter_class=argparse.RawDescriptionHelpFormatter, epilog=""" 示例: # 加载项目上下文(JSON 格式) python project_memory_loader.py # 加载项目上下文(Markdown 格式) python project_memory_loader.py --format markdown # 精简模式 python project_memory_loader.py --compact # 离线模式 python project_memory_loader.py --offline # 获取记忆质量报告 python project_memory_loader.py --action quality # 预览重复记忆合并建议 python project_memory_loader.py --action merge --dry-run # 执行重复记忆合并 python project_memory_loader.py --action merge # 清理过期记忆 python project_memory_loader.py --action cleanup # 运行完整维护 python project_memory_loader.py --action maintenance """ ) parser.add_argument( "--format", "-f", choices=["json", "markdown"], default="json", help="输出格式 (默认: json)" ) parser.add_argument( "--refresh", "-r", action="store_true", help="强制刷新缓存" ) parser.add_argument( "--compact", "-c", action="store_true", help="精简模式,只返回核心信息" ) parser.add_argument( "--offline", "-o", action="store_true", help="离线模式,直接读取本地文件" ) parser.add_argument( "--action", "-a", choices=["quality", "merge", "cleanup", "maintenance", "report"], help="执行维护动作" ) parser.add_argument( "--dry-run", action="store_true", help="试运行,只返回结果不执行" ) parser.add_argument( "--api-url", default=DEFAULT_API_URL, help=f"API 端点 URL (默认: {DEFAULT_API_URL})" ) parser.add_argument( "--timeout", type=int, default=10, help="API 请求超时时间(秒)(默认: 10)" ) args = parser.parse_args() loader = ProjectContextLoader( api_url=args.api_url, offline=args.offline, timeout=args.timeout ) # 执行维护动作 if args.action: result = loader.call_maintenance_action( args.action, dry_run=args.dry_run ) print(json.dumps(result, ensure_ascii=False, indent=2)) sys.exit(0 if result.get("success") else 1) # 加载上下文 result = loader.load_context( format=args.format, refresh=args.refresh, compact=args.compact ) # 输出结果 if args.format == "markdown" and "content" in result: print(result["content"]) elif "fallback" in result and result.get("offline"): # 使用降级数据生成 markdown md = loader.generate_markdown_summary(result["fallback"]) print(md) else: print(json.dumps(result, ensure_ascii=False, indent=2)) # 设置退出码 if not result.get("success", True): sys.exit(1) if __name__ == "__main__": main()
